Sources and context

We prioritise announcements from developers, publishers and platforms. We link to the original source and distinguish reporting by other outlets. An official source explains an announcement; it is not an independent test of a game's quality.

Dates, prices, platforms and availability must retain their region and conditions. An announcement for one country should not be presented as a worldwide launch. We aim to explain what changes for players and which questions remain open.

News, analysis and expectations

Analysis is labelled. A screenshot, patent or interpretation alone cannot confirm a feature. Hypotheses must be identified as such, including in headlines and summaries.

We do not present impressions as reviews of games we have not played. English and Spanish versions should preserve the same facts and qualifications.

AI assistance and review

Our editorial system uses AI to help prepare some stories and translations. Those articles are labelled as AI-assisted, even when their image changes. Automated checks evaluate publishing requirements and detect some text defects; they do not replace fact-checking or guarantee originality.

The label ‘Editorial team article’ identifies stories maintained directly in our editorial archive. It does not, by itself, certify a recent check of every claim.

Corrections and updates

When correcting a material fact, we retain the original publication date and add a note explaining the change and its source. An update date should not be confused with a new publication.

Images, advertising and independence

Images include credits and source links. Attribution does not replace permission or the rights holder's terms of use.

Ad placements must be labelled and separated from editorial content. Paid collaborations and links that earn compensation must be disclosed. Preparing the site for advertising does not endorse the advertised products.
